Hi all, as you may now I've had Eddie and Elsa for a few weeks now. They have come on amazingly in such a short spell of time and are much more confident around me now, they were even nosing about as I was cleaning their hutch this morning :D They are still scared to be handled though. I'm trying not to push it too much.
Eddie is neutered but Elsa hasn't been spayed yet although I am intending to do so. Elsa has built one nest since being with me, she's def not pregnant though. She's not nasty at all, more timid than anything. Kareen has told me that Elsa was prone to phantom pregnancies while she was at the rescue with her... My question is, I will get there in the end ( :lol: ), would you get Elsa spayed immediately as she's obviously hormonal due to the nest building but not nasty to me or wee Eddie... or would you leave them to settle in for a bit longer?? i'll be taking her into the house afterwards until she's better.

I'd go ahead and get her done, after all she should be reasonably used to you

Yep get her done but don't split her from Eddie, take them both to the vets and if your bringing her into the house bring him aswell.
 
Id suggest getting her done asap while she is still getting used to you - Rather then her being settled, trusting you and then being taken to be done!

Once she is done, you can build her trust up gradually without her having an op in the middle :D
